M365 Application/ Power Platform Developer – Warwick / Hybrid
Salary: £35,000 – £45,000 DOE
Working for an established company based in Warwick, we are seeking an experienced M365 Application/ Power Platform Developer. This role is hybrid, requiring 2 days per week in Warwick. You will play a critical role acting as the glue between non-technical Business Units and the M365 Applications team, working with key stakeholders to understand pain points and processes, harnessing the power of M365 to realize business benefits. Your responsibilities include streamlining manual processes through the power of M365 and showcasing all that is possible within the suite of applications. You will contribute to the ongoing improvement and development of the existing Microsoft 365 environment through user engagement, support, troubleshooting, and development of Power Apps across both desktop and mobile devices. The adoption of M365 is still fairly new, so there are many opportunities to add value early on.
Experience & Skills we would like to see:
- 1-2 years experience in a similar role where you have worked with Power Apps
- Focus on the use of Intranet, SharePoint, and Microsoft O365 applications globally, delivering to end users. Develop processes, deploy features, and provide application support to all functional areas and business units.
- Promote user adoption of SharePoint and Microsoft O365 applications through technical demonstrations, consultation, and support of existing functionality
- Change Management
- System Configuration and Development
- Ability to present solutions
- User training
- Process Documentation and configuration
